使用 GitHub Pages 创建中文网站的完整指南

介绍

GitHub Pages 是一个强大的工具,允许用户免费托管静态网站。本文将详细讲解如何使用 GitHub Pages 创建和发布中文网站,帮助开发者和创作者轻松分享他们的作品。无论是个人博客、项目展示还是作品集,GitHub Pages 都能满足你的需求。

GitHub Pages 的基本概念

GitHub Pages 主要用于托管静态网站,其优势在于:

  • 免费:GitHub 提供免费的托管服务,用户无需承担任何费用。
  • 易于使用:GitHub 的界面友好,操作简单。
  • 集成版本控制:使用 Git 管理网站内容,方便追踪和更新。

创建 GitHub Pages 的步骤

1. 注册 GitHub 账号

在使用 GitHub Pages 之前,首先需要注册一个 GitHub 账号。可以前往 GitHub 官网 完成注册。注册过程非常简单,只需提供邮箱、用户名和密码。

2. 创建新仓库

登录 GitHub 后,点击右上角的“+”号,选择“新建仓库”。

  • 仓库名称需要以 username.github.io 的形式命名,其中 username 为你的 GitHub 用户名。
  • 勾选“初始化此仓库为 README”以便后续操作。

3. 上传网站文件

在创建的仓库中,可以上传 HTML、CSS 和 JavaScript 文件。建议使用Markdown文件撰写内容,GitHub Pages 支持 Markdown 格式,可以轻松生成网页。

  • 点击“上传文件”,选择本地文件,或者直接拖拽上传。

4. 配置 GitHub Pages

在仓库的设置中找到“Pages”选项,选择主分支作为发布来源。保存设置后,系统会生成一个链接,用户可以通过此链接访问网站。

5. 自定义域名(可选)

如果你希望使用自定义域名,可以在仓库设置中找到“自定义域名”选项,填写你的域名并进行验证。

如何发布中文内容

发布中文内容相对简单,你可以直接在 Markdown 文件中使用中文。确保文件编码为 UTF-8,以避免乱码问题。

1. Markdown 语法

使用 Markdown 编写内容时,可以参考以下基本语法:

  • 标题:使用 # 符号,例如 # 这是标题
  • 列表:使用 -* 符号,例如 - 项目1
  • 链接:使用 [链接文本](链接地址) 语法。

2. 插入图片

通过 Markdown,可以轻松插入图片,语法为 ![图片描述](图片链接)。确保图片链接有效,或直接上传到 GitHub。

常见问题解答

1. GitHub Pages 是什么?

GitHub Pages 是 GitHub 提供的一项服务,允许用户托管静态网站和博客,支持 Markdown 格式,非常适合开发者和创作者。通过简单的设置,用户可以将项目的文档或个人网站快速发布。

2. GitHub Pages 是否免费?

是的,GitHub Pages 完全免费,用户可以使用其服务创建个人网站、项目展示等,而无需支付费用。

3. 如何设置自定义域名?

在仓库设置中找到“Pages”选项,填写你的自定义域名并进行 DNS 验证,确保域名正确指向 GitHub 的服务器。

4. 如何更新网站内容?

更新内容非常简单,只需在本地编辑文件后,推送到 GitHub 仓库,GitHub Pages 会自动更新网站。

5. 如何处理中文乱码问题?

确保所有文件的编码为 UTF-8 格式,避免出现乱码问题。如果在 GitHub Pages 上发布的中文内容显示乱码,可以检查文件编码设置。

结论

GitHub Pages 是一个强大的工具,能够帮助用户轻松创建和发布中文网站。通过上述步骤,你可以快速搭建个人博客、项目展示等,让更多人了解你的作品。无论你是开发者还是内容创作者,GitHub Pages 都是一个值得尝试的选择。希望本文对你有所帮助,祝你在使用 GitHub Pages 的旅程中一切顺利!

正文完